  10. mcp770's Avatar
    Yea upgraded from stock .75 to .122 and my battery has nearly doubled in life with normal use. Running slacker for 5 hours and using the other functions all day would drain the life of any phone quicker than normal. I have a buddy with an iphone and he goes nowhere without his charger if that says anything. Also turn your GPS off or to 911 only and you will save tons of battery life.

  16. dysfunction5100's Avatar
    Decrease the brightness of your phone. I did that recently and it helped a ton. I used to have a dead battery by the time I'd leave work around 6 pm (after an overnight charge). I get no signal at work so that doesn't help. Today I've been up and running for about 28 hours and still have 40% battery. You won't even notice the brightness being lowered after a day or so (I turned it down to 50%).
